How are water, power and internet?
low confidenceOld Cantonment BWSSB mains: established Cauvery supply with the ageing-pipe caveats of a century-old quarter; no shortage pattern in reviews.
- Power cuts
- Reliable central-grid BESCOM; tree-fall outages in storms are the local quirk.
- Roads
- 60/100
- 5G
- Availablegood on Jio, Airtel
- Broadband
- ACT, Airtel and JioFiber serve the quarter.quality good
- Garbage collection
- Routine BBMP collection; the quarter is kept.
- Parking
- ScarceThe documented pinch: narrow heritage lanes with limited parking; bungalows have compounds, apartments juggle.

Who lives here?
medium confidenceHeritage Bangalore at its most intact: monkey-top bungalows, jacarandas and rain trees, close-knit streets that know their history, minutes from the modern city.
- Mostly
- Old Bangalore families, professionals and expats in heritage bungalows and boutique apartments; a long Anglo-Indian and Christian thread shared with the Cantonment.
- Households
- Settled families and long-tenure residents; low turnover by central standards.
- Income bracket
- Affluent
- Expat presence
- High
- Pet-friendly societies
- High
- You will mostly hear
- English first in daily life, with Kannada, Tamil and Hindi across the quarter.

What does Cooke Town cost?
low confidence- 1BHK rent
- ₹25,000approximate
- 2BHK rent
- ₹40,000approximate
- Buying
- ₹12,000 to ₹20,000 per sqft
- The neighbourhood is
- Stable
- Coming up
- Heritage scarcity economics: bungalow plots rarely trade, boutique apartments command central-premium rents, and the Pink Line's arrival on the quarter's edge is the next repricing. Buy-side supply is the constraint, not demand.

What residents say
medium confidence- Overall
- Very positive
- On Reddit
- Universally warm: one of the city's loved addresses, with cost and parking as the only consistent gripes. Grounded in portal reviews and guides this pass.
Praised for
- Heritage bungalows and rain-tree lanes minutes from the CBD
- Quiet, green, close-knit, the Cantonment at its best
- Strong heritage schools and central hospital access
- Mosque Road and Kammanahalli food belts as neighbours
Complained about
- Expensive: heritage pricing on rents and the rare plot
- Limited parking on narrow lanes
- No big malls close by
- Peak congestion at the Wheeler Road/Banaswadi edges
